Scene: Setting

Food: The big bay doors of the machine shop have been opened and tables set in the openings laiden with food. Large aluminum pans of mashed tatters, corn, biscuits are set up to cater to whatever sized group shows up. The main attraction are the wide selection of main dishes. Everything from vegetarian curry to barbequed pork, grilled salmon and steak with some whole, rotisserie chickens - juicy and herb-flavored to whet the appetite.

Drinks: At the end of the line are a mixture of different coolers, each one filled with ice and drinks in a set up where people take what they want and move on. Selections include beer, water and a few brands of soda for those interested.

Tables: Sheets of plywood have been set up on saw horses to create long tables for people to sit and eat at before taking their comfort around the fire.

Fire Ring: Chairs, benches and everything in between have been set in a large circle around the central fire where the flames are kept moderately high to provide light and warmth for the crowd. See also: .details/firepit for additional information.


Today the red head known as Erin doesn't bring cookies she brings some tray of meats and cheese. She hums a little bit as she heads over to the food table and sets it down. She smiles at the older kinfolk trying to look super innocent before she heads off to decide where she will lean this evening or hide.


Scene: Welcome

Icon-Wolf-01.png

Bergin walks into the center of the yard and glances over to the food being served for tonight's feast before raising his bottle to get people's attention. A few of the Boyz(tm) are running between the pans of food out for people to pick from as well as the coolers to make sure that everything is ready for the guests. Mrs. Marry pops two fingers into her mouth to let out an ear-splitting whistle to to quiet folks down.

The young, bearded theurge smiles at the kinfolk's assistance and clears his throat with a faint smile. "Hey folks, for those who are new to the Gathering, let me first welcome you all here. I'm Jay Bergin, called Foe Hammer by the People but most people know me simply as Bergin or Berg." He smiles and looks around the gathered crowd as folks still continue to arrive and grab their food to settle in.

"As you can see we have plenty of food and drink for ya tonight and you're welcome to take your fill." He takes a sip from his beer and smacks his lips with an audible 'Ah' in enjoyment. "But, since there are some who are either newly arrived to the community or it's their first time at the Gathering, I'd like everyone to introduce themselves so we might get to know you a bit better."


Scene: News

The bearded Get theurge gives people a bit to take in his welcome before he explains how he has planned the evening. "As has become tradition here at the Gathering, and while we're all getting nice and cozy around the fire, I've asked one of the Community to tell us a Tale of the People. This week we have the honor of hearing one of the stories of the Children of the Bear." After a quick sip to let that sink in, the lumberjack of a Get picks right back up and continues to walk around the fire as he speaks.

"In the past we've thrown axes and spears to test our accuracy in combat. But -this- week, at the suggestion of Mrs. Marry, we're going to do something different. This week...will be a test of strength and of team work for those who wish to pick up the burden..." a faint pause to add a bit of drama to the moment before he continues to explain, "...and see if they can pull the other side into a huge and gaping pit of mud."

Hopefully people came wearing old clothes - or at least those who heard from last week. "Also, just a quick bit of news from the Daughter of Mother Bear, she is still looking for recruits to form a team of Smokejumpers to help fight the fires that have raged across the lands. All those interested in helping should speak to Tabi here," he points to the blonde-haired woman gathered around the firepit.
